How do you mean by a "smart" form, and also what do you mean by adding photo's?

 

If you are talking about uploading photo's, and then sending the pic's data to the database, then you can just use a normal upload form and then loop the FILES global and do it that way. more on that here...

 

If your talking about editing the values already held in the database, again a simple loop will do, just select the column names and populate a form with the values.
